This podcast's mission is to discuss junior tennis with a focus on the journey and process of player development. We discuss trends in junior development and promote tennis events at all levels, including college, Futures, Challengers, ATP/WTA, and local events. We would like to invite our audience to share our experience raising competitive junior tennis players in the USA. We will discuss the highs and lows of being a Payer as we support our Players.

Joao shares his tennis journey from being a top ranked junior in Chile to playing college tennis at UT San Antonio and in Chile. He has experience coaching tennis in Chile, Switzerland and the US, and is currently working at Tucker Tennis Academy in Tulsa, Oklahoma.

Episode 96 - Tomas Descarrega

Born and raised in Rosario, Argentina, Tomas he was ranked #1 in Argentina in the 12U, 14U, and 16U. He played college tennis at LSU and West Florida. Tomas is currently a teaching pro at Tucker Tennis Academy in Tulsa, Oklahoma.

Cooper Woestendick (Olathe, KS) is currently ranked #13 ITF, and recently competed in the Junior Australian Open where he made the QFs in singles and won the Doubles title with his partner Max Exsted (Savage, MN). Cooper shares his junior tennis journey from training with his dad in Kansas City to his current residence at the USTA National Campus in Florida. We talk with legendary Georgia Head Coach Manny Diaz about his coaching career, including coaching the great Al Parker and ATP Top 10 John Isner. We also dive into his coaching philosophy, how he has been able to maintain a winning culture for 36 years, recruiting and the outlook for the Bulldogs in 2024.

Dr. Jayanthi leads Emory's Tennis Medicine program, is the Director of Emory Sports Medicine Research and Education, and co-directs Emory’s Youth Sports Medicine program. He is considered one of the country’s leading experts on youth sports health, injuries, and sports training patterns, as well as an international leader in tennis medicine. ASU Head Coach Matt Hill. Matt shares his story of surviving cancer while in college, how that changed his career path, and why reviving the Arizona State tennis program has been so special. We also discuss college tennis recruiting, how he prepares for matches, and what we can expect from the Sun Devils in 2024. Part 1

Andrew Goodwin is the head coach at Georgia Southern. As a junior, he was a top 100 player from Alpharetta, GA and played collegiately at Southern Miss and Alabama. After working at the USTA, he returned to college with assistant coach positions at Michigan, Mississippi State, Charlotte, and Tulsa.

Marc Lucero has coached Genie Bouchard, Nicole Gibbs, Allie Riske-Armitraj, Shelby Rogers and Steve Johnson, as well as coaching out of the USTA's West Coast facility in Carson, CA. Mark shares his background and talks about the role of a professional coach. He addresses overcoming vulnerabilities, ball recognition, how he grades success or failure, and how to play defense. David Roditi is one of the most successful coaches in college tennis - TCU is the only school to finish in the ITA Top 10 for nine straight years. We talk with Coach Roditi about his tennis background, coaching philosophy, what he looks for in recruits, coaching ATP top 10 player Cam Norrie, and of course his hats.
